Pakistani journalist Muhammad Manaf condemns unchecked attacks on media, demanding legal protection amid a dangerous climate for reporters.

Pakistani journalist Muhammad Manaf has denounced widespread attacks and harassment against media professionals, calling press freedom a hollow promise.

He highlighted ongoing intimidation, violence, and self-censorship driven by fear of retaliation, despite journalists’ vital role in exposing societal issues and supporting democracy.

Manaf criticized the government for failing to deliver accountability or legal protections, noting that attacks on reporters go unpunished, fueling a climate of fear.

He urged passage of a special law to protect journalists and ensure justice.

Press freedom groups confirm Pakistan remains one of the most dangerous countries for reporters, with threats persisting despite official claims of support.
